The number of hours per week that the television is turned on is determined for each family in a sample. The mean of the data is 35 hours and the median is 31.2 hours. Twenty-four of the families in the sample turned on the television for 20 hours or less for the week. The 12th percentile of the data is 20 hours. Step 1 of 5: Based on the given information, determine if the following statement is true or false. The 55th percentile is greater than or equal to 30 hours. 1: Approximately how many families are in the sample? Round your answer to the nearest integer.
2: Based on the given information, determine if the following statement is true or false. Approximately 200 families turned on their televisions for less than 35 hours.
3: What is the value of the 50th percentile?
4: Based on the given information, determine if the following statement is true or false. The first quartile is greater than or equal to 20 hours.
